CyberLink's 2026 annual shareholders' meeting approved the lifting of non-compete restrictions for several directors and their representatives, allowing them to engage in specified competitive activities during their tenure. The company confirms no impact on its financial or operational performance.

- Q: What is the legal basis for the non-compete waiver?
- A: It is based on Article 209 of Taiwan's Company Law, approved by shareholder resolution.
